1936 Photos of Zanzibar and Tanganyika from the US Library of Congress

Readers who live(d) in Zanzibar or Tanzania, have visited the marvellous East African countries, or are somewhat familiar with the beautiful continent of Africa, will be thrilled to view a collection of photos dated 1936 at Simerg’s companion website, www.simergphotos.comThe photos are from the Matson (G. Eric and Edith) Photograph Collection which is housed at the US Library of Congress. Please click Beautiful People and Places of Zanzibar and Tanganyika: Photos from 1936 or on the image below.

    Re the above photos, the photo number 12 is taken from the same vantage as photo number 31. The scenery is of Dar es Salaam harbour featuring 7 sailing yachts and not of Zanzibar. The structures going from the shore/beach into the sea are drains from Dar es Salaam town. You can just about see the roof of the German Boma towards the left hand side and in between the palm trees in the photo.
